Handover for the TumbleVault locker flow: I finished migrating the access-token exchange from the old Pinhole gateway to Latchkey v2. Users now get a single-use unlock code after payment clears, with a 10-minute expiry. Known gap: re-issuing a code after a failed door sensor read still requires a manual override in the admin console. Edge cases, state diagrams, and my remaining TODOs are documented on the internal wiki page below.

operations page: https://jenkins.zemvarcloud.local/job/merge_requests/repo/build/73930b4b30f0a8ed

Finance Review — Reseller Programme

For the finance team. Q2 reseller revenue through the Calden Alliance Programme: 4.1M, up 6% on plan. Commission payouts accrued correctly; two disputed claims resolved. Channel margin at 38%, within guardrails. Bad-debt exposure concentrated in one distributor; provision raised by 120K. Forecast unchanged for Q3. Please align accrual schedules before close. The strategic context for next quarter's channel changes is set out below.

confidential, kagup-bafog: Fraaxax Group is in early talks to buy Soroxox Group for about $343.8 million. The Olidor launch date is June 14, and nothing goes to the press before then. Legal wants the Aldmirek Logistics term sheet signed before July 23.

This PR replaces the naive charset sniffing in Textgate's upload pipeline with a staged detector. We first check for a BOM, then run a confidence-scored heuristic pass, and only fall back to the tenant's declared default when confidence is low. Files under the minimum sample size skip heuristics entirely to avoid noisy guesses. Tests cover mixed UTF-8/Latin-1 corpora and a pathological UTF-16 case that previously misclassified. Reviewers should focus on the fallback ordering. The detector's tuning constants are:

constants for bawif-kawif:
QUOTAS = {
    "ulaael": 5,
    "holael": 10,
}